Protoss Air

Phase Prism
Built From: Robotics Facility
Armament: None
Role: Tactical Transport
For thousands of years the Protoss have studied the nature of time and space. Through their painstaking studies and experiments protoss researchers have uncovered many of the secrets of the universe. Using psionic manufacturing processes, the protoss have learned how to create a robotic mind whose programming is built into the molecules of an advanced crystal lattice. This "crystal computer" is able to manipulate matter and energy with a precision no ordinary organic mind could comprehend.


The protoss use these "phase prisms" in several ways. Their primary function is to transport protoss forces on the field of battle. Both living and inorganic subjects can be transformed into energy, and their unique energy signature imprinted into the prism's crystal lattice core. Upon reaching the destination point the operation is reversed and the stored energy signatures are reconfigured into matter in proximity to the phase prism.
Phase Prism's power ability in conjunction with Warp Gates allows Protoss to quickly field reinforcements


A secondary but no less vital function of the phase prism is to act as a mobile focus for the protoss psionic matrix. Once the prism is deployed it will power protoss structures around it. In this configuration phase prisms are often used to temporarily replace destroyed pylons in a colony or enable the rapid establishment of a forward base of operations.



Phoenix
Built From: Stargate
Armament: Twin Ion Cannons
Role: Air Superiority Fighter
The phoenix is a swift and deadly spacecraft that is rapidly replacing the older scouts and corsairs in the role of fighter for the protoss. Phoenix patrols are a common sight on the outer rim of protoss territory, where they sweep deep space for alien threats. The twin ion blaster armament of a phoenix is highly suited to air-to-air combat and can also be used for strafing light ground targets.



Sophisticated and lethal as the phoenix may be, all too often a patrol squadron will find itself heavily outnumbered by zerg or terran enemies. To overcome this weakness, phoenix pilots have developed a dangerous counter-ploy. A phoenix pilot can unleash a short-lived storm of destruction by overloading its warp field through the ship's ion blasters.

The area-effect discharge is devastating and can destroy a large number of enemies at once, but it comes at a price: in the aftermath the phoenix is left temporarily powerless and crippled. Wary foes have learned to flee a phoenix overload and return moments later to destroy the helpless craft. In turn phoenix pilots have begun to use staggered discharges to catch their enemies in a web of destruction.

Warp Ray
Built From: Stargate
Armament: Prismatic Beam
Role: Long-range Bombardment
The reunification of the Aiur protoss and the dark templar has been a time of great trials for both peoples. Overcoming the centuries of fear and mistrust that built up after the exile of the dark templar is no easy task. Nonetheless, the melding of technologies that developed along separate paths for so long has heralded spectacular new developments for the protoss. One such creation is the warp ray, a new capital vessel that many believe will eventually replace the venerable protoss carrier as flagship of the protoss fleet.



A warp ray is a ship virtually built around a single gigantic power source: the prismatic core. This device seethes with energy drawn from two realms: the Void, which is truly understood only by the dark templar, and the psionic matrix, which underpins the technologies of the Aiur protoss. In combination these two energies form a self-sustaining reaction of terrifying potential.

Normally the prismatic core is held in check by an arrangement of flux field projectors. When a warp ray locks on to a target, the projector arms smoothly part like the petals of a flower. A complex array of warp lenses and phase-crystals works to focus the energies of the prismatic core into a ravening beam of destruction.



As the prismatic beam is held on the target, more of the focusing array becomes aligned, and up to three individual power streams combine together. Over a few seconds the beam's intensity and power grow exponentially. Few enemies can withstand the awful power of the prismatic beam for long: even large and heavily armored targets like buildings or battlecruisers are incinerated in moments.



Carrier
Built From: Stargate
Armament: Interceptors
Role: Capital Ship

The massive carriers serve as operations centers for leaders of the protoss fleets. Heavily armored and shielded, carriers can punch their way through enemy blockades by unleashing flights of robotic interceptors at vital enemy targets. These maneuverable, computer-guided craft tear through enemy flight formations and relentlessly strafe slower ground targets with potent plasma charges.



Interceptors are automatically manufactured and serviced inside the carriers’ bays, and a number of prepped interceptors can be launched in rapid succession. In battle, carriers appear to be virtual hornets’ nests of activity as their agile offspring dart out to launch their attacks and retreat just as rapidly to repair any damage they sustain. Terran scientists have long yearned for an opportunity to study just how the smoothly orchestrated operations of a carrier are achieved in detail.



Most carriers have no weapon batteries of any kind, but their deployment of interceptor flights makes them devastating in a ship-to-ship battle. However, a handful of heavily armed "super carriers" exist, most famously the Gantrithor. This was the flagship of Executor Tassadar when he led a protoss expeditionary force in its attempts to eradicate the zerg in terran space. The Gantrithor was powerful enough that it single-handedly defeated an entire terran battlecruiser squadron under the command of General Edmund Duke. Tassadar later sacrificed himself and his ship to destroy the zerg Overmind when it manifested on Aiur.



Mothership
Built From: Stargate
Armament: Disruptor Pulse
Role: Capital Ship

rotoss motherships are mighty vessels that were constructed centuries ago during the golden age of protoss expansion. They were intended to act as primary command ships to lead vast armadas of protoss explorers into the darkness of deep space and bring them safely home again. Those days are long gone, and the surviving motherships later became holy shrines to the protoss, representing an honored way of life and a part of the proud history of the protoss race.



At the heart of each mothership is a huge khaydarin crystal infused with an incredible amount of psionic energy. By tapping into this energy, a mothership can warp or crack the very fabric of space and time itself. The devastating power of a mothership can wipe out squadrons of enemy ships in the blink of an eye or lay waste to entire planets. As the golden age reached its apogee, the motherships were left in place as titanic monuments at the farthest reaches of protoss exploration. It was believed that their like would not be needed again.



After the loss of Aiur, however, the motherships were called back into service from the far corners of the galaxy. Now they are crewed not with mystics and historians, but with warriors. The oldest and most powerful weapons of the protoss have been awakened and are prepared to burn the galaxy to avenge the loss of the protoss homeworld.
